Lyin' Luke Lionel

Limerick of a Linguistic Looter

By James AlbertPublished about a year ago 1 min read
1
(AI Generated Image)

Luke Lionel lied very often,

to steal goods from strangers he’d soften.

Then, he lied to a spy;

But he wasn’t to die,

not before being crammed in a coffin.
